
Beren Cross: Tottenham interest in Patrick Bamford not serious
Tottenham Hotspur are not particularly interested in signing Leeds United striker Patrick Bamford this summer, believes Beren Cross.
According to The Telegraph, the London side were contemplating a move for the Whites attacker given the uncertainty surrounding Harry Kane.
The reliable Leeds-based journalist, in a Q&A for LeedsLive, was asked by a fan whether the reported interest from Spurs in the England international was genuine.

To which he responded, “Not that I’m aware of.”
